The Peace Region Family Resource Network (FRN) is expanding and we’re looking for someone amazing to join our passionate, community-focused team!

If you're a people person who thrives in both creative and organized environments, this dual role could be the perfect fit. This position combines Parent Education Programming with HUB Administration, offering the best of both worlds: planning fun, hands-on programs for children and families and being the friendly, welcoming face of our FRN Hub at the Baytex Energy Centre.

The FRN is a contract for service with the Government of Alberta – Children’s Services, that provides service to a large area – as far as Manning and Clearhills County.

What You’ll Be Doing:

  • Plan and deliver engaging programs and events for children and youth (ages 0–18)
  • Develop and maintain a welcoming, interactive play space for young children (ages 0–6)
  • Co-facilitate parenting courses, offer tip sheets, and conduct developmental screenings
  • Collaborate with families and partner agencies to support healthy child development
  • Greet and orient new families visiting the Hub
  • Answer phones, register families for programs, and connect them with community supports
  • Manage FRN social media pages and communications
  • Design fun and informative brochures, posters, calendars, and activity guides
  • Keep our brochure wall and library organized and up to date
  • Travel occasionally across the region for program delivery
  • Work some evenings and weekends (adjusted hours)
  • Represent the Town and FRN in a positive, professional way

What You Bring:

  • Training or experience in Early Childhood Education, Child & Youth Programming, Social Work, or a related field
  • Knowledge of trauma-informed care, child development, and family support services
  • Strong communication, organizational, and multitasking skills
  • A friendly, approachable attitude and passion for helping families thrive
  • Confidence using social media and basic computer programs
  • Creativity and energy to plan awesome programs and events

What You Need:

  • Valid driver’s license, reliable vehicle, and insurance (travel is required)
  • Clear RCMP Vulnerable Sector and Intervention Record checks
  • Standard First Aid/CPR certification
  • Willingness to work in all kinds of conditions (sometimes outdoors or in physically active settings)
  • Ability to lift supplies, move small furniture, and stay on the go
  • A working cell phone, or we can provide one!
  • Recommended: up-to-date immunizations and TB test
